The dollar ax the world’s reserve currency depends strongly on America’s power and influence, and a major part of that influence rests on America guaranteeing global security. Without this, there is no motivation for other countries supporting the Breton Woods agreement that cemented the dominance of the dollar in global trade.

Believe me, you do not want to see the USD collapse, because the demand for the USD has been keeping the US economy afloat for decades in spite of levels of spending other countries could only dream of.
